Testing a new pain tablet after abdominal surgery

Moderate to Severe Acute Postoperative Pain

Treatments studied

Part of Pain clinical trials.

This trial tests a new pain tablet (HL-1186) for people having abdominal surgery. It aims to see if the tablet is safe and works well to manage pain after the operation.

Who can take part

  • You must be between 18 and 75 years old.
  • Your weight should be in a healthy range (BMI 18 to 30).
  • You must be scheduled for surgery on your belly (abdomen) under general anesthesia.
  • You must be able to understand the study and a pain scale.
  • You cannot have certain heart, lung, or bleeding conditions, or be allergic to the study medicine.
